The Baker Cabin Historic Site in Oregon City, Oregon, encompasses a 4-acre park that honors the legacy of 19th-century pioneers Horace and Jane Hattan Baker. Visitors can explore two historic buildings, the 1856 log cabin and a relocated pioneer church from 1895, set within a serene woodland backdrop.
Offering educational experiences for families, the site features self-guided tours with interpretive signs detailing the life of early settlers. The historic buildings are open to the public during select times throughout the year, inviting guests to embrace Oregon's rich heritage through tours and special events.
